5 Essential Tips for Choosing the Right Cable for Your Next Project
Choosing the right cable for your next project is crucial to ensuring its success and efficiency. To help you navigate through the myriad of options available, here are 5 essential tips to consider:
- Determine the Purpose: Identify the specific application of the cable. Will it be used for electrical wiring, networking, or audio-visual equipment? Understanding the intended use will guide you in selecting the appropriate type, such as coaxial, HDMI, or Ethernet cables.
- Consider the Length: Measure the distance between your devices and ensure you purchase a cable that is long enough to avoid any connectivity issues. It's always better to have a bit extra length than to come up short.
Additionally, you need to pay attention to cable ratings. Look for cables that are rated for the environment in which they will be used—indoor cables might not hold up outdoors, for example. Furthermore, check the gauge of the wire; thicker wires can handle more current, making them suitable for high-voltage projects. Lastly, always opt for reliable brands to ensure you are investing in quality and safety.
- Check Compatibility: Ensure that the cable you choose is compatible with your devices. Compatibility issues can lead to a frustrating experience and may hinder the overall effectiveness of your project.
- Price vs. Quality: While it might be tempting to go for the cheapest option, investing in a quality cable can save you money and hassle in the long term.

How to Safely Replace Worn-Out Cables: A Step-by-Step Guide
Replacing worn-out cables is essential to ensure safety and maintain the efficiency of your devices. Before starting, gather the necessary tools: a screwdriver, wire cutters, and heat shrink tubing. Begin by carefully disconnecting the power source to avoid any risk of electric shock. Once the power is off, inspect the cables for any visible damage such as fraying or exposed wires. If you see significant wear, it’s critical to replace them. Follow these steps:
- Remove the old cable by unscrewing any connectors or fixtures.
- Cut the new cable to the appropriate length, ensuring it matches the old cable.
- Strip the ends of the new cable to expose about half an inch of wire.
Now that you have prepared your new cable, it’s time for the installation phase. Start by connecting the new cable to the appropriate ports or fixtures, ensuring that the connections are secure. Use wire connectors or solder where necessary to ensure a robust connection. After securing the cable, use heat shrink tubing to cover any exposed wiring for added safety. This step not only protects the wires but also prevents any accidental contact with conductive surfaces. Finally, restore power to the device and test it to ensure everything is functioning correctly. Following these guidelines will help you safely replace worn-out cables and enhance the longevity of your equipment.
What Are the Benefits of Upgrading Your Cables for Better Performance?
Upgrading your cables may seem like a minor detail, but it can have a significant impact on your device's performance. High-quality cables are designed to minimize interference and enhance data transfer rates, ensuring that you enjoy a smoother and more responsive experience. For example, investing in high-speed HDMI cables can improve video and audio quality, providing a more immersive entertainment experience, especially when streaming 4K content. Additionally, better cables can support greater bandwidth, allowing you to take full advantage of your devices' capabilities and any upgraded hardware you may have.
Another essential benefit of upgrading your cables is their durability and longevity. Cheap, poorly made cables are more prone to fraying, breaking, or losing conductivity over time. By opting for upgraded cables, you not only enhance performance but also reduce the frequency of replacements. A solid investment in quality cables can save you money in the long run while ensuring reliable connectivity for your devices. Improved signal integrity and reduced latency are just some of the advantages that come with premium cables, making them a worthwhile upgrade for anyone looking to optimize their setup.
